I grew up here and this would have been when I was about 8. We moved in in the winter, I think November or December 1968. My Dad painted the barn and the house and added shutters and a new roof by this time. I remember it was all in need badly. There were no trees directly behind the house, just off to the side. Those 2 trees were black walnut and they were messy, but the only shade to play in on a hot summer day. My mother didn't want us playing by the road. My sister was 10, brothers were 6 and 3.
